mrpayroll Posted December 19, 2009 #3 Share Posted December 19, 2009 If staying on site, getting around is no problem without a car. Saratoga is closer to Downtown Disney area. Using the Disney bus system you can get everywhere you need to go. If you haven't been to Disney, it can be very overwhelming. DisneyBlonde Posted December 20, 2009 #4 Share Posted December 20, 2009 I've stayed at both and prefer the layout and amenities at Old Key West. All room configurations at OKW are larger than the same room type at any of the other timeshare properties.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

rasta Posted December 26, 2009 #6 Share Posted December 26, 2009 Can't compare to Saratoga but Key West was great with a very large 1 bedroom apartment. Overlooked a golf course and the bus sytem was easy to use as well. Lot's of pools scattered throughout Key West also. also had a washer and dryer in the apratment.
